Abstract

PURPOSE:To use for all application points with an impact absorber of the same shape by deforming an impact absorber freely for fitting it to the application points. CONSTITUTION:An impact absorber 11 provided between a door inner panel 3 and a door trim 5 consists of a foaming element 13 which has divided blocks 17 divided into plural pieces by a cut-out 15 on one surface, and a sheet material provided on the other surface of the foaming element 13. The sheet material is affixed onto either of the door inner panel 3 or the door trim 5.
